Overview

***This is a PMI-Led webinar*** This session deepens PMI research on enterprise agility, exploring real world examples of implementation in action from both the executive and practitioner perspectives. Our experts will highlight how all stakeholders have to be active, empowered players in enterprise agility for it to succeed, emphasizing the need for psychological safety and strong communication pathways.

Learning Objectives

Explore the perspectives and disconnects of executives and practitioners in agile organizations.
Recognize the common challenges that arise when strategy isn’t aligned across the organization.
Identify solutions and best practices to resolve common challenges across organizational hierarchies.
